Pakistan: 8 killed in rain-related accidents

Massive rains flanked by gusty winds wreaked havoc in northeast and northwest Pakistan

By Aamir Latif

KARACHI, Pakistan (AA) - At least eight people were killed and over 20 injured after heavy rains flanked by gusty winds wreaked havoc in northeast and northwest Pakistan on Saturday, local media reported.

Six were killed and another 16 injured in the northwestern Bajuar Agency tribal region along the Afghan border in separate roof-collapse incidents, local broadcaster Dawn News reported, quoting local officials.

Pakistan army troops already stationed in the region to maintain law and order were called in to join rescue operations.

Another two people were killed and several injured in rain-related incidents in the northeastern Bhakkar district, the outlet reported.

Footage on multiple TV channels showed trees and utility poles knocked down by torrential rains, and heavy winds lying on inundated roads and streets in various cities.

Heavy winds also blew away roofs from dozens of houses in Bajuar Agency, Bhakkar, Gujranwala, and other cities apart from causing major power outages.
